电气控制编程是什么工作
-
电气控制编程是一种工作,主要负责设计、开发和维护电气控制系统的软件程序。电气控制编程员需要具备电气工程知识和编程技能,以实现对电气设备的精确控制和监测。
首先,电气控制编程员需要对电气控制系统的原理和组成部分有深入的了解。他们需要了解电气设备、传感器、执行器、PLC(可编程逻辑控制器)等硬件设备的工作原理和特性。此外,他们还需要了解各种传感器和执行器的接口和通信协议,以便能够正确地与这些设备进行交互。
其次,电气控制编程员需要熟练掌握各种编程语言和软件工具。常见的编程语言包括 ladder diagram(梯形图)、structured text(结构化文本)和 function block diagram(功能块图)等。他们需要根据具体的控制需求,选择合适的编程语言来编写控制程序。此外,他们还需要使用各种软件工具来调试和测试控制程序的正确性和稳定性。
最后,电气控制编程员需要具备良好的问题解决能力和沟通能力。他们需要能够快速分析和解决电气控制系统中的问题,并与其他相关部门或人员进行有效的沟通和协作。此外,他们还需要能够理解客户的需求,并根据需求进行控制系统的设计和编程。
总结来说,电气控制编程是一项需要综合电气工程知识和编程技能的工作。电气控制编程员通过设计、开发和维护电气控制系统的软件程序,实现对电气设备的精确控制和监测。他们需要了解电气控制系统的原理和组成部分,熟练掌握各种编程语言和软件工具,并具备良好的问题解决能力和沟通能力。
1年前 -
电气控制编程是一种将电气和控制技术应用于工程系统中的工作。它涉及编写和调试电气控制系统的软件代码,以实现对设备、机器或工艺的自动控制。
以下是电气控制编程的一些工作内容:
-
编写PLC程序:PLC(可编程逻辑控制器)是一种常用的控制设备,用于监测和控制机器和工艺过程。电气控制编程人员负责编写PLC程序,包括设置输入输出(I/O)点,定义逻辑功能和算法,编写控制逻辑等。
-
HMI编程:HMI(人机界面)是用户与电气控制系统交互的界面。电气控制编程人员负责编写HMI程序,包括设计和布局界面,编写图形化控制元素,设置报警和故障处理等。
-
调试和测试:电气控制编程人员负责调试和测试电气控制系统,确保系统的功能和性能符合要求。他们需要检查和排除电气连线、传感器和执行器的问题,验证PLC和HMI程序的正确性,进行模拟和实际运行测试等。
-
现场支持:电气控制编程人员可能需要在现场提供支持,包括安装和调试控制设备,处理现场问题和故障,与其他工程师和技术人员合作等。
-
文档编写:电气控制编程人员需要编写相关的技术文档,包括设计规范、用户手册、操作指南等,以便其他工程师和用户理解和操作电气控制系统。
综上所述,电气控制编程涉及编写和调试电气控制系统的软件代码,以实现对设备、机器或工艺的自动控制。这项工作需要熟悉电气和控制技术,具备编程和调试能力,并能进行现场支持和文档编写。
1年前 -
-
电气控制编程是指通过编写程序来控制电气设备和系统的工作。在工业自动化领域中,电气控制编程是非常重要的一项工作,它负责实现对各种电气设备、机械装置和自动化系统的控制和监控。电气控制编程包括了控制器的配置、编程和调试等工作,以确保设备和系统能够按照预定的要求运行。
一、电气控制编程的方法
电气控制编程的方法主要有以下几种:
-
Ladder Diagram(梯形图):梯形图是一种图形化的编程语言,它使用电路图的形式表示控制逻辑。梯形图主要由连线和逻辑元件组成,如继电器、计时器、计数器等。通过梯形图编程,可以方便地表示电气控制逻辑,易于理解和调试。
-
Function Block Diagram(功能块图):功能块图是一种图形化的编程语言,它使用方框和箭头表示控制逻辑。功能块图主要由功能块和信号线组成,功能块表示具体的功能模块,信号线表示数据的传输。通过功能块图编程,可以将控制逻辑分解为多个功能模块,提高了程序的可读性和可维护性。
-
Structured Text(结构化文本):结构化文本是一种文本化的编程语言,它使用类似于高级编程语言的语法和结构。结构化文本主要由变量、函数和控制语句组成,可以实现复杂的控制逻辑和算法。通过结构化文本编程,可以灵活地实现各种控制功能,但需要具备较高的编程能力。
二、电气控制编程的操作流程
电气控制编程的操作流程主要包括以下几个步骤:
-
设计控制逻辑:根据实际需求和设备特性,设计电气控制逻辑。这包括了确定输入和输出信号、选择合适的控制器和传感器、编写控制策略等。设计控制逻辑需要充分了解设备和系统的工作原理,以确保控制逻辑的准确性和可靠性。
-
配置控制器:根据设计的控制逻辑,选择合适的控制器,并进行配置。配置控制器包括设置输入和输出信号、调整控制参数、连接通讯网络等。配置控制器需要按照设备和系统的要求进行,以确保控制器能够正常工作。
-
编写控制程序:根据设计的控制逻辑,编写控制程序。控制程序的编写可以使用梯形图、功能块图或结构化文本等编程语言。在编写控制程序时,需要注意编程规范和代码质量,以提高程序的可读性和可维护性。
-
调试和测试:将编写好的控制程序下载到控制器中,并进行调试和测试。调试和测试包括验证控制逻辑的正确性、检查输入和输出信号的正常工作、调整控制参数的合理性等。通过调试和测试,可以确保控制器和程序的正常运行。
-
系统集成:将电气控制系统与其他系统进行集成。系统集成包括连接传感器和执行器、配置通讯网络、实现数据交换等。通过系统集成,可以实现设备和系统之间的协同工作,提高整个自动化系统的效率和可靠性。
-
运行和维护:将调试完成的电气控制系统投入运行,并进行日常维护。运行和维护包括监控系统的运行状态、处理异常情况、更新控制程序等。通过运行和维护,可以确保电气控制系统的稳定性和可持续性运行。
三、电气控制编程的工作内容
电气控制编程的工作内容主要包括以下几个方面:
-
设计和编写控制逻辑:根据实际需求和设备特性,设计和编写电气控制逻辑。这包括了确定输入和输出信号、选择合适的控制器和传感器、编写控制策略等。设计和编写控制逻辑需要充分了解设备和系统的工作原理,以确保控制逻辑的准确性和可靠性。
-
配置和编程控制器:根据设计的控制逻辑,选择合适的控制器,并进行配置和编程。配置和编程控制器包括设置输入和输出信号、调整控制参数、连接通讯网络等。配置和编程控制器需要按照设备和系统的要求进行,以确保控制器能够正常工作。
-
调试和测试控制程序:将编写好的控制程序下载到控制器中,并进行调试和测试。调试和测试控制程序包括验证控制逻辑的正确性、检查输入和输出信号的正常工作、调整控制参数的合理性等。通过调试和测试,可以确保控制器和程序的正常运行。
-
系统集成和调试:将电气控制系统与其他系统进行集成,并进行调试。系统集成和调试包括连接传感器和执行器、配置通讯网络、实现数据交换等。通过系统集成和调试,可以实现设备和系统之间的协同工作,提高整个自动化系统的效率和可靠性。
-
运行和维护:将调试完成的电气控制系统投入运行,并进行日常维护。运行和维护包括监控系统的运行状态、处理异常情况、更新控制程序等。通过运行和维护,可以确保电气控制系统的稳定性和可持续性运行。
总之,电气控制编程是通过编写程序来控制电气设备和系统的工作。它需要设计和编写控制逻辑、配置和编程控制器、调试和测试控制程序、系统集成和调试,以及运行和维护电气控制系统。通过电气控制编程,可以实现对各种电气设备、机械装置和自动化系统的控制和监控。
1年前 -